Diving Deep into the Lyrics of "Love Story"
Okay, Swifties, let's get into the heart of the matter: the lyrics! "Love Story" is more than just a catchy tune; it's a beautifully crafted narrative that draws you in from the very first line. The song reimagines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et, but with a happier ending, giving listeners a sense of hope and optimism. Taylor's songwriting genius lies in her ability to take a classic tale and make it relatable to a modern audience.
The opening lines, "We were both young when I first saw you," immediately set the scene and establish the innocence of young love. As the song progresses, Taylor paints a vivid picture of a relationship facing disapproval and adversity. The lyrics, "My daddy said, 'Stay away from Juliet,'" perfectly capture the conflict and the obstacles the couple must overcome. The use of the name Juliet is a clever nod to the original Shakespearean play, instantly creating a sense of familiarity and drawing the listener into the story.
But what truly makes "Love Story" so special is its message of hope and perseverance. Despite the challenges, the protagonist remains steadfast in her belief that their love is worth fighting for. The chorus, "Romeo, save me, they're trying to tell me how to feel, This love is difficult, but it's real," is an anthem for anyone who has ever faced opposition in their relationships. It's a declaration of independence and a refusal to let others dictate their feelings.
And of course, we can't forget the iconic bridge: "He knelt to the ground and pulled out a ring, And said, 'Marry me, Juliet, You'll never have to be alone, I love you and that's all I really know.'" This is the moment when the story takes a turn for the better, offering a satisfying resolution that deviates from the tragic ending of Romeo and Juliet. It's a moment of pure romance and a reminder that love can conquer all.
